Re: TimeRanger 03 released
The Time Robo has a "3D Formation" Meaning 3 modes in one. That's why Alpha, Beta, and then Gamma. Beta does get to finish off monsters. But Alpha is the mode that can only use the Time Tunnel. To summon the sword. The show is new. Gotta show off everything.
